While the home buying process can be expedited, "instant" buying is a relative term․ Factors that contribute to the speed of purchasing a home include:
Having your finances in order is crucial․ Buyers with substantial cash reserves or pre-approved mortgages can move quickly when they find the right property․
The real estate market's current state significantly influences transaction speed․ In a seller's market, homes can sell quickly, necessitating swift action from buyers․
Modern technology has revolutionized home buying․ Virtual tours, online listings, and digital signatures allow buyers to streamline the process․
Cash offers are often more attractive to sellers, as they eliminate the uncertainties associated with mortgage approval․ Buyers with available cash can close deals more quickly․
A knowledgeable real estate agent can help navigate the process efficiently, offering insights and connections that can speed up transactions․

While the allure of quick home buying is tempting, it is essential to consider potential risks:
Speed can lead to hasty decisions that may result in buyer's remorse․ Take the time to evaluate your options․
In a rush to close, buyers may neglect crucial inspections or fail to thoroughly read contracts․
Purchasing a home quickly can strain your finances, especially if unexpected costs arise post-purchase․
